The white LED launched linear synchronous step-up DC/DC converter

Corporation launched synchronous step-up DC/DC converter LTC3490 optimized for driving high current white LED. LTC3490 to work efficiency as high as 90%, to prolong the battery run time, and the input voltage range of 1V to 3.2V so that it can be from a single or double alkaline / NIMH provides current up to 350mA. The output voltage range from 2.8V to 4V is fully in line with the forward voltage requirement of high current LED. LTC3490 provides constant current drive for applications requiring up to 1W LED power. 3mm x 3mm DFN package (or SO-8) and 1.3MHz switching frequency so that it can provide solutions for handheld applications for slim board area.

When the output load disconnect, LTC3490 can set the output voltage is limited to 4.7V, so as to enhance the reliability of system. The on-chip analog dimming function is proportional to the CTRL/SHDN pin voltage to reduce the LED drive current. The low battery logic output indicates that the battery voltage has been reduced to less than 1V, and when each section is 0.85V, the undervoltage lockout circuit turns off the LTC3490 to enhance the protection. LTC3490 offers the most compact 1W LED driver solution for portable lighting and rechargeable flash applications.

Performance overview: LTC3490

350mA constant current output 2.8V to 4V output range to meet the requirements of 1 - or 2 Ni MH metal or alkaline battery input - synchronous rectification efficiency: - fixed frequency operation up to 90% 1.3MHz - low static current: < 1mA - low shutdown current: < 50uA - open circuit LED output limit to 4.7V - VIN range: 1V to 3.2V dimming control, undervoltage lockout to protect the battery - flat (0.75mm) 3mm x 3mm thermally enhanced 8 lead DD and S8 packages
